Join the herd and unlock your opportunity.Why You'll Love This RoleThe Sr Data Engineer will be responsible for driving high quality data across Cribl by scaling our data tech stack and championing data best practices. You will be a key contributor to our centralized Data team, partnering closely with Data Analysts, IT, Security, and Engineering functions. This role reports to the Senior Director of Data & Analytics.As An Active Member Of Our Team, You Will ...* Build, manage, and monitor Cribl's core data tech stack including data pipelines (ETL), data integrations and data warehouse* Engage with cross-functional stakeholders to understand system dependencies and creatively formulate solutions to complex, unstructured problems* Design and implement data quality processes for compliance and data validation* Partner with Data Analysts, Site Reliability Engineers, and IT Engineers on initiatives that align with business needs* Automate manual processes, scale data workflow management, and manage any data system impact analysisIf You Got It - We Want It* Experience in managing, architecting, and improving data warehouse/pipeline infrastructure* Hands-on experience in SQL, and workflow management tools (Airflow, Prefect, e.g.)* Strong Python coding skills and fundamentals* Familiarity with managing and deploying the modern data tech stack (Snowflake/Redshift, dbt e.g) and AWS cloud ecosystem* Experience with common IaC tools (Terraform, Terragrunt, CloudFormation, etc)* Working knowledge of cloud network infrastructure* Strong organization skills to effectively manage and lead strategic projects, while prioritizing ad-hoc request* Excellent communication skills to work with dynamic teams and communicate ideas to technical and non-technical audiences* Comfortable with ambiguity, have a strong analytical acumen, self-motivated, able to work cross functionallyBonus Points / Preferred Skills* Working experience at a fast-growing SaaS company* Experience scaling a function at a remote first companySalary Range ($135,000 - $190,000)The salary for this role is dependent on geographic location. The salary offered within the range described will be based on the individual candidate's job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.
